This textbook, titled "Concrete Mathematics: A Foundation for Computer Science," is a comprehensive guide for students and professionals in the field of computer science. Written by renowned authors Ronald Graham, Donald Knuth, and Oren Patashnik, this hardcover book is published by Pearson Education The Limited in 1994. The book consists of 672 pages and covers various topics such as algorithms, data structures, mathematical foundations, and probabilistic models. The book is 244 mm in height, 201 mm in width, and weighs 1200 g. It is written in English and is a valuable resource for those studying or teaching computer science.
